A dream I’ve had since I was 16 has finally come true after 56 years. I am now the proud owner of a ’65 Belvedere II. A very well preserved 2dr h/t with a 426 wedge, 4-speed and wearing its original dark blue finish. Doing maintenance, tuning, tinkering and just getting acquainted with it in general at this time.
I bought the car at ebay auction in August. Details on the car and pictures taken by the seller can be seen at https://www.ebay.com/itm/194266539257. As it has passed through several hands over the years, I’m hoping one or more FBBO members will recognize this car and share any history they know about it with me. It would be of great help to know about any internal engine mods, especially bore, stroke and/or camshaft changes.
